Transportation Options
- Dublin Bus: The extensive bus network offers convenient routes throughout the area, making it easy for you to explore without a car.
- DART (Dublin Area Rapid Transit): This commuter rail service provides quick and scenic access along the coast, connecting you to Dublin city center and beyond.
- Taxi and Ride-Sharing Services: Reliable options like taxi services and ride-sharing apps are readily available, offering flexible transport within the region.
- Car Rentals: Renting a car from local providers gives you the freedom to explore the area at your own pace and visit nearby attractions effortlessly.
